LIME to ‘help access overseas market’

LIME has formed partnerships with a number of experts in the international field, including a direct service and mortgage introductions as well as a specialist property agent.

The direct service is offered through Own Overseas, which is backed by the Lloyds TSB Group. Its aim is to help intermediaries who have clients wishing to buy property in Spain with a Spanish mortgage through Scottish Widows. The service also includes an introduction to an English speaking Spanish law firm and full support in ongoing client requirements, such as opening a Spanish bank account.

Clients can also be introduced to overseas specialists, Belvins Franks Mortgage Services and Conti Financial Services, who both handle the whole transaction and pay a percentage of the procuration fee.

For brokers wishing to use a specialist property estate agent, the Premier International Group has a network of introducers and property specialists available. It assesses each client’s needs and directs them to the most appropriate property firm.

Simon Conn, managing director for Conti Financial Services, said the service meant intermediaries would no longer have to turn away clients who are interested in buying abroad. He said: “The overseas market is very big and we get around a 100 enquiries a day about it. This service means that brokers won’t have to say no to their clients if they come to them about buying property overseas. Brokers now have an outlet to go to. So many people rush into buying property abroad and don’t do all the right checks, so this will help brokers get their clients the right information.”
